I've found I prefer the .45 ACP over the .40 S&W. I just don't like the "snap" of the recoil of the .40, whereas the .45 ACP is more of a rude "push" back into the flesh of the palm. I've owned a few different handguns of different bore, but I think my two favorites are the 1911 in .45 ACP and my little .38 Sp J-frame. I've fired both the .454 and the .500... and they are made for bear, not bad guy! I have never shot a .10mm, however, I came close to buying a Colt Delta Elite sight-unseen a while back.
